The most important factor a user considers when selecting a public cloud service provider may be the uptime or the availability warranty of the cloud service provider. Rackspace claims to have an uptime of 100% while AWS claims to have an availability guarantee of 99.95%. AWS’s approach to this is more realistic which provides them with the proper to truly have a downtime of 4.3 hours anytime in a yr. In case of network failures, an individual always wants to find out the MTTR (Mean time to resolve) claimed by the cloud company. While AWS decides never to specify the MTTR, Rackspace promises to solve issues in enough time span of 1 one hour. If Rackspace does not resolve the issues in the period of time specified, they owe the user credits for network use as a penalty. This is something that Amazon should include within their SLA. If AWS or Rackspace violates any clause specified by them in the SLA, the user/customer gets the proper to notify the companies about the same. After notifying the company the customer must obtain the credit from the firms. Amazon must pay the customer a credit of 10% period while Rackspace owes the client 100% credit rating if it vindicated. Likewise, if the storage provider provided by the companies goes down for quite a while AWS offers 25% credit to the client while Rackspace once again owes the customer 100% credit. The foundation of cloud servers is made on shared resources. Thus, regarding Rackspace the client with the bigger ‘Flavor’ (instance) is given top priority in a rack. But in the case of Amazon Web offerings, the client gets the providers he/she will pay for. Variable performance is offered by Rackspace, while dedicated overall performance is the key characteristic of AWS. With regards to storage Rackspace charges a person with 10 cents/GB of storage, while AWS charges 14 cents/GB up to 1 1 TB of info storage. Outgoing bandwidth being an essential factor, plays an integral role in deciding the general public cloud company for the client. Rackspace charges the customer with 18 cents/GB. However, AWS does not charge the customer with an individual penny for the earliest GB of outgoing bandwidth. But, later after the initial GB, AWS charges the customer 12 cents/GB up to at least one 1 TB. AWS, obviously is a win-win situation with regards to outgoing bandwidth. Likewise, there AWS has important features of spot instances and reserved occasions. Rackspace does not have any such feature to offer which can help an individual reserve instances for long term use with guaranteed effectiveness.
